- Аудит управления изменениями в программном обеспечении: ключ к стабильности и развитию
- Что такое управление изменениями и зачем он нужен?
- Что входит в аудит управления изменениями?
- Как провести эффективный аудит управления изменениями?
- Преимущества проведения аудита управления изменениями
- LSI запросы к статье
Аудит управления изменениями в программном обеспечении: ключ к стабильности и развитию
Представьте себе корабль‚ бороздящий бескрайние морские просторы. Каждая его часть должна быть идеально слаженной‚ чтобы пройти через штормы технологий и непредсказуемых ветров изменений. В мире программного обеспечения управление изменениями — это навигационный компас‚ который помогает команде не сбиться с курса‚ не потерять ценные ресурсы и сохранить устойчивость системы. Аудит управления изменениями в ПО — это как детальное обследование этого компаса‚ проверка его точности‚ исправность механизмов и корректность отображения направления.
Когда мы говорим об аудите изменений‚ перед нами раскрывается картина‚ насыщенная деталями: кто‚ когда‚ почему и как вносит изменения‚ как эти изменения документируються и контролируются. Без тщательного анализа такими процессами можно управлять‚ словно рулём в темной ночи, попытки без разума приводят к сбоям‚ потерям данных и даже катастрофам. Поэтому аудит — это инструмент‚ который помогает нам понять‚ насколько система управления изменениями эффективна‚ и выявить слабые места‚ чтобы исправить их до того‚ как маленькая трещина превратится в пролом.
Что такое управление изменениями и зачем он нужен?
Управление изменениями в программном обеспечении, это структурированный процесс приемов и мер‚ предназначенных для планирования‚ согласования‚ внедрения и контроля изменений в системе. Этот процесс подобен заботливому садовнику‚ что нежно ухаживает за растениями‚ предотвращая их чрезмерный рост или болезненные повреждения. В основе лежит идея — не допустить бесконтрольных трансформаций‚ которые могут разрушить гармонию системы.
Зачем это нужно? Ответ кроется в базовых принципах эффективности и надежности:
- Минимизация рисков — чтобы не допустить сбоя или потери данных при внесении обновлений.
- Обеспечение соответствия стандартам — соответствие политикам внутреннего контроля и нормативным требованиям.
- Повышение качества продукта — исправление ошибок и улучшение функционала без нежелательных последствий.
- Обеспечение прозрачности процессов, чтобы все участники знали‚ что и почему меняется‚ создавая предсказуемость и доверие.
Что входит в аудит управления изменениями?
В ходе аудита происходит комплексное исследование документов‚ процессов и практик‚ связанных с управлением изменениями. Он включает в себя:
- Анализ документации — проверка процедур‚ политик‚ инструкций и отчетов.
- Оценка внедренных инструментов — систем контроля версий‚ трекинга изменений и согласования.
- Обзор процессных практик, как происходит коммуникация‚ согласование и внедрение изменений.
- Интервью с участниками — разработчиками‚ менеджерами и тестировщиками.
- Проверка соответствия стандартам и нормативам — ISO‚ ITIL‚ внутренним политикам компании.
Как провести эффективный аудит управления изменениями?
Для успешного проведения аудита нужно подойти как к расследованию‚ где каждый штрих важен. Вот ключевые этапы:
- Подготовка: сбор документации‚ формирование команды и постановка целей.
- Анализ текущего состояния: детальный разбор существующих процессов и практик.
- Выявление слабых мест: нахождение разрывов‚ дублей или избыточных процедур.
- Рекомендации и план улучшений: разработка конкретных мер по усовершенствованию.
- Отчетность: подготовка итогового отчета и презентация результатов руководству.
Преимущества проведения аудита управления изменениями
Регулярный аудит — это не просто формальность. Это мощный инструмент‚ который позволяет закрепить внутри команды понимание важности стандартизации и контроля. Ключевые преимущества:
- Повышение надежности системы: выявление уязвимостей и их устранение.
- Оптимизация процедур: сокращение бюрократии и снижение времени внедрения изменений.
- Улучшение коммуникации: налаживание каналов обратной связи и согласования.
- Обеспечение соответствия требованиям: минимизация рисков штрафных санкций и репутационных потерь.
Вопрос: Почему аудит управления изменениями важен в современном мире разработки программного обеспечения?
Ответ: В быстро меняющемся мире технологий‚ где каждое нововведение может стать и спасением‚ и причиной сбоя‚ аудит управления изменениями становится краеугольным камнем — он помогает держать систему под контролем‚ избегая хаоса и обеспечивая устойчивое развитие продукта.
LSI запросы к статье
Подробнее
| управление изменениями в IT | аудит процессов в программном обеспечении | методики аудита управления изменениями | стандарты контроля изменений | инструменты для аудита ПО |
| процессы внедрения изменений | оставшиеся риски в проекте | стратегии управления изменениями | регламенты по управлению проектами | обзор систем контроля версий |
| улучшение процессов в IT-компаниях | корректность документации по изменениям | распределение ответственности при внесении изменений | контроль качества релизов | эффективность управления проектами ПО |
